Homemade Marinara/Spaghetti Sauce

This is our basic spaghetti sauce recipe ... sometimes we add ground beef, meatballs or chicken (o:

Ingredients:

2 (28 ounce) can crushed tomatoes
4 (8 ounce) cans tomato sauce
2 (6 ounce) can tomato paste
garlic cloves (depending on how much you like garlic. My husband & I LOVE garlic & usually throw in about 10 whole cloves)
1 tablespoon garlic powder (once again ... depends on how much you like garlic)
2 tablespoon white sugar
4 tablespoons red wine vinegar
4 teaspoons dried oregano
2 pinch crushed red pepper flakes

Directions:

In a large skillet combine crushed tomatoes, tomato paste, tomato sauce, garlic, sugar, vinegar, oregano and red pepper flakes. Stir together and simmer over low heat for at least 1 hour. Stir frequently to prevent burning.

This will make a big pot of marinara/spaghetti sauce ... luckily it freezes wonderfully (o: We were very happy when we saw that Costco started carrying organic crushed tomatoes, tomato sauce & tomato paste.
